Assam & Tripura To be Worse Affected with CAB: KMSS

Reacting onUnion Home Minister Amit Shah's stand on Citizenship Amendment Bill (CAB),Krishak Mukti Sangram Samiti (KMSS) chief Akhil Gogoi said that theirprediction was right.

Amit Shah onSaturday said that CAB will be implemented in the states other than the 6thschedule area and inner line permit area. Reacting to it KMSS chief said withthe implementation of CAB Assam and Tripura will be loaded with foreignersadding that this condition will not be accepted.

Gogoi saidthat another lure will come from Delhi and that lure has been taken to Delhi bythe state government.

Gogoi said, "HimantaBiswa Sarma said that 5-6 lakhs of foreigners will come once CAB will beimplemented but that is not true. With the implementation of CAB, 20 lakhspeople will grant citizenship and around 1 crore 70 lakhs people will enterAssam in the future."

He furtherstated that the Constitution of India will be violated once CAB will beimplemented in the state adding that they won't accept CAB in anycircumstances.

He alsoappealed to the people not to accept the conditions of the BJP who went toDelhi adding that if the Hindus are assaulted in Bangladesh then Prime MinisterNarendra Modi should stop this with social power by sending army personnel.
